U19s finish with Brighton win

 
A match up against traditional rivals Old Brighton in a contest for ladder honours – the winner would end the season on top of the loser. OB clearly took the game seriously, to the extent they decided to play an ex-Rover who hadn’t been registered … the problem was that he started the preseason with us! He sat out the second half.

In any event, after a relatively even first half, Old Brighton just couldn’t keep the Rovers in hand and we romped away after half time to record a 36 point victory. The last month has been good for the under 19s, finishing the season with three big wins, and this victory was all the more impressive when you consider that there were 9 other U19s who pulled on the green and gold in the seniors later in the afternoon.

Sam Gall, playing at CHB was a rock in defence and picked up the BOG award. Skipper Scotty Ebbott continued his good form and Corey Jones bagged another 4 goals in a good display of forward work.

Both Tom Sherry on the wing and Harry Robertson playing on the wing and the ball clearly had the better of their opponents and improved the further the game progressed. Benji Audige dropped back to the U19s owing to a commitment in the afternoon, and took the ruck duties. He was delighted in playing back in his age group without the bigger bodies of the seniors. Teamed with Sean Bourke they dominated in the ruck all day.

Coach John Cesario saved his praise for the back six who he said played their best game of the year. With only a few players set to be ineligible for U19s next year, it should be a promising 2017 for the young Rovers.

HAMPTON ROVERS  2.4  5.5  11.7  12.10 (82)
OLD BRIGHTON  3.1  5.1  6.2  7.4 (46)
Goal Kickers: C. Jones 4, A. Woolston 3, S. Ebbott 2, L. Cosgrif, S. Bourke, T. Sharry
Best Players: S. Gall, S. Ebbott, C. Jones, H. Robertson, T. Sharry, A. Woolston
